HINOWATCH ROADSIDE ASSISTANCE PROGRAM:
The Hinowatch Roadside Assistance Program provides peace of mind driving, since our customers know that assistance
is only a toll free phone call away. We will dispatch a service provider to your location if you run out of fuel, need a battery boost,
towing service, or if you have accidentally locked your keys in your truck. Bilingual dispatch staff is available 24 hours a day to
answer your questions and direct you to the nearest Hino dealership. This very popular program is provided to our customers at
No Extra Charge, and covers your new Hino truck for 3 years (see Dealer for details).

VISIBILITY:
Recognizing the important role that visibility plays in safe driving, Hino has
included several visibility enhancing features. Our trucks have a large
windshield, a high seating position, well positioned A-pillars, and a hood
which drops away sharply, providing the driver with an unobstructed view
of the road ahead. Night time visibility is enhanced with a high performance
headlamp system.
